Schema migrations in Driftwell run in expand-contract mode, so readers never see a half-applied change — new columns land first, backfill runs async, and the old path gets dropped only after traffic drains. From a security angle, the migration runner is a separate principal with write-only DDL scope. To audit its recent operations via the internal API, use the key that follows.

service key, tadup-tahog: zpat7_wB1tnEL

## Deploying the Gatewick Proctor Queue

Deploys are pretty painless: push to main, wait for the pipeline, then watch the queue drain dashboard for five minutes. If candidates pile up mid-exam, roll back first and ask questions later — the queue replays safely. Everything the workers care about lives in one config block, shown here for reference.

settings of bafof-yagef:
JOROX_PIN=8740
JOROX_TENANT=pelox
JOROX_METRICS_HOST=metrics.jorox.qorvelworks.internal
JOROX_SEAL=seal_c78f63c1
JOROX_STANDBY_TEAM=norax

## Cron Drift Review Notes

During the Lanterby audit we traced the cron drift to an unsynced clock on the batch host. Remediation is complete; evidence is archived in the review bundle. To open the sealed bundle, the console will prompt for a recovery passphrase, which we record here for the reviewer.

strongbox words: sorir-belvan-rusix-ulays-ralmir-praix-eliir-tamax-praael-druael-julir-tamius-jorir

Office Closure — Hartvale Site, Bramley Analytics (Managers Only)

The Hartvale office will close at the end of Q3. Eleven staff are affected: eight will move to remote arrangements, and three have been offered relocation to the Dunmore site. The lease break clause has been exercised and facilities handover is scheduled. Heads of department should not communicate this to teams until the formal announcement date. Severance provisions, where applicable, follow standard policy. The confidential note below covers the business-plan implications.

internal memo for yahag-tahog: The pricing group signed off on a budget of $152.8 million for Project Soriel.